Sankranti and the Comfort of Homemade Food
Sankranti recipes are simple, yet deeply meaningful. Til-gud laddoos, chikkis, khichdi, pongal, and sweet rice dishes don’t rely on complexity, they rely on timing, patience, and the right cookware.
These are recipes passed down through generations, often prepared slowly, with attention to detail. Which is why the cookware you use matters more than you might think.
A heavy base that distributes heat evenly, a surface that allows smooth stirring, and a build that handles long cooking hours, all of this quietly supports the tradition you’re keeping alive.
